Here’s a rundown on updates on the 11.1″ Sony Vaio X netbook:

We know now more about the Sony Vaio X. It…

* has a 3-hour regular battery and a 14-hour extended battery (US buyers can get the extended battery in the package but those in Japan will have to buy it separately.)
* will weight 1.5 pounds
* has 2GB RAM, and 128GB SSD
* has multi-touch trackpad
* has a 2.0GHz Atom Z550
* will come with Windows 7 Home Premium or Professional
* comes in three color variations: Premium Carbon, Gold and Black
* has additional options include: Built-in WiMAX and 3G
* comes at a base price of $1299.99

Nope. No need to rub your eyes. It really IS $1299.99. We’re basically looking at a really expensive netbook right now. Is a 2.0GHz Intel Processor worth a thousand bucks? Or is it just the Vaio name that we’d be paying for?
